How To Animate Characters In Unity 3D | Animation Layers Explained

Поділитися
Вставка
  • Опубліковано 30 лип 2024
  • Learn the fundamentals of animating characters with Unity's animation layers, and understand how & why it all works!
    This beginner-friendly tutorial is a thorough break down of Animation Layers in Unity 3D and explains how each of the layer's properties work and are useful. By the end of the video, our character is able to walk and aim simultaneously!
    SUPPORT THE CHANNEL:
    💛 / iheartgamedev
    iHeartGameDev Merch:
    💛 www.iheartgamedev.com
    This is the seventh video in a series covering Unity's animation system! Be sure to check out the other videos in the series to continue learning!
    WANT MORE?
    Interested in learning more about animating characters in Unity? Check out my growing series of tutorials:
    ✅ • Unity's Animation System
    ✦ Like the vid? Please consider Subscribing!
    bit.ly/2YdIb6j
    ✦ Missed out on the last episode?
    • How to Move Characters...
    SOCIAL:
    ✦ Discord
    / discord
    ✦ Twitter
    / iheartgamedev
    LINKS FROM THE VIDEO:
    🤖 Download Jammo for YOUR game:
    assetstore.unity.com/packages...
    ⭐ And Check Out MixAndJam!
    / mixandjam
    ►TIMESTAMPS:
    Intro: 0:00
    What are layers for?: 0:28
    Project Setup Mixamo: 1:26
    Import Characters to Unity: 2:26
    Convert To Humanoid: 2:35
    What Does Humanoid Do?: 2:59
    Setup Scene And Character: 3:19
    Setup Walk Animation: 3:46
    Animator Grid: 3:57
    First Animation Layer: 4:08
    Add Layer animation: 4:29
    Animation Layer Settings: 4:46
    Layer Weight Explanation: 4:59
    Avatar Mask Intro: 5:46
    Avatar Mask Humanoid Settings: 6:00
    Using Avatar Mask: 6:22
    More Humanoid Settings: 6:41
    Avatar Mask IK Example: 6:54
    Avatar Mask Transform Settings: 7:30
    Blending Settings: 8:02
    Blending Override Explained: 8:08
    Blending Additive First Explanation: 8:27
    Blending Additive Example: 8:43
    How Additive Layers Are Tricky: 9:54
    How Additive System Works: 10:21
    Additive Reference Pose Example: 10:42
    Interactive Additive Example: 11:20
    Two KeyFrame Crouch: 12:03
    Sync Setting Explained: 12:17
    Sync Practical Example: 12:44
    Timing Setting Explained: 13:22
    Timing Example: 13:40
    Timing Re-described: 14:25
    IK Pass Setting Explained: 14:46
    IK Pass Example: 15:00
    Outro: 15:25
    Next Time:15:30
    Thank you for stopping by and checking out my tutorial -- Hope you all enjoy! Please feel free to leave any questions & feedback you may have. This will help shape the direction and style for upcoming videos!
    Thanks again for watching!
    #indiegame #gamedev #indiedev #2020

КОМЕНТАРІ • 466

  • @Noixelfer
    @Noixelfer 3 роки тому +148

    As always, the quality of the explanations is just the best. I can't even describe how perfect the pacing and the video demonstrations are, well done!

    • @Noixelfer
      @Noixelfer 3 роки тому

      @@iHeartGameDev It definitely is, thanks to the animations you keep the viewers engadged while also providing aditional informations on the presented topic

  • @Boujonzu
    @Boujonzu 3 роки тому +15

    Seriously dude, probably some of the best unity tutorials. The fact that you go over EVERYTHING makes this more like a lecture than a regular tutorial

  • @Herdetzy
    @Herdetzy 3 роки тому +3

    I watched all of your tutorials from start to finish ... this step my step really helped me and the best tutorial out there for the unity animation system!

  • @mixandjam
    @mixandjam 3 роки тому +55

    Such a well explained video!! Thanks for it Nicky!

  • @N0Mana
    @N0Mana 3 роки тому +29

    Can't thank you enough for the tutorials, man.
    There aren't enough advanced, concise, and digestible animation tutorials for Unity, and you help fill in that gap.

  • @moniques1377
    @moniques1377 2 роки тому +5

    Just started watching these recently, and I gotta say - these videos are PHENOMENAL!! Thank you so much for all your hard work 💜

  • @00031849
    @00031849 3 роки тому +15

    This channel needs more visibility because it's a real gem on youtube!

  • @GymCritical
    @GymCritical 3 роки тому +12

    I didn’t even bother with layers in my project and avoided them because I didn’t want to get into it too deep. You made it a lot easier to grasp. Those equations in the beginning were incredibly useful. Thank you.

  • @aldigangster123
    @aldigangster123 3 роки тому +1

    You explained things in this video I've never heard of before - and I've watched a lot videos on Unity Animation. Awesome stufff! Thank you so much!

  • @Underarmour81
    @Underarmour81 3 роки тому +3

    Man this type of explanation is top tier, you should honestly think about putting a paid course together. I'd pay for it.

  • @runehammergaming9580
    @runehammergaming9580 3 роки тому +3

    This tutorial series has been invaluable to me. Clear instructions with visual examples, concise and sticks to the point of the video instead of being an hour long hard to follow tutorial where the narrator just rambles. Prior to finding these videos my animation setup was unruly and very amateurish. Now the setup is clear and easy to read, professional, and most importantly, bug free. You are saving my game with this series. I'm not an animator, and while my art is good and my coding skills sharpen all the time, using Unity mechanim was a nightmare for me. Thank you for this series.

  • @enduroeveryday1325
    @enduroeveryday1325 3 роки тому

    I love how you show an example of every setting! Keep up the great work!!

  • @RussmanDesignHD
    @RussmanDesignHD 3 роки тому +1

    The Quality of the Explanation is on such a level. Just based on these videos so far. I was able to fix and produce a great prototype. I would love to show you it~! Thank you for your time and knowledge! Please keep it up!

  • @lukegf0
    @lukegf0 2 роки тому +1

    Wow there is some much complexity, and power, to the Unity animation system and you explained it so well. Very impressive!

  • @XURlMA
    @XURlMA 2 роки тому +24

    Throughout my entire career of learning from tutorials, this is the only channel that not only goes over what each setting does, but also how they can be useful, which in my opinion is just as important as understanding what something does, you just can't have one without the other. Hope it inspires others to do the same :).
    Also, HUGE props, must take lots and lots of effort to make these vidoes, but it will help a whole lot of people immensely, and for that you earned my sub despite me never subscribing to anyone really :) It will definitely pay off for both you and others, keep it up man!

    • @iHeartGameDev
      @iHeartGameDev  2 роки тому +5

      Thank you very much for such kind words!

    • @workthenplay
      @workthenplay 2 роки тому +2

      Completely agree with this. Well done!!

  • @Chickengbs
    @Chickengbs 3 роки тому +1

    You're so underrated Nicky! Thank you so much for sharing this useful knowledge with us all. We cannot wait and we're excited to learn more from the best teacher you are.
    Thank you!

  • @CosmicComputer
    @CosmicComputer 3 роки тому

    Man your tutorials are seriously the best, they are to the point but at a steady pace to follow easily AND I like how you explain WHY we do something and what the goal is before you explain HOW to do the thing. Excellent format! Thank you!

  • @freedom6984
    @freedom6984 3 роки тому +1

    OMG have been looking for ages for smt like this! thank you so much man!

  • @wulumgames
    @wulumgames 2 роки тому +1

    Excellent video. I was looking for this content for a while.

  • @Jobzachariah
    @Jobzachariah 3 роки тому

    This is a well explained video with over the top production quality.Looking forward to see more video related to animation. Good Work Nicky!!

  • @berkcan3475
    @berkcan3475 3 роки тому

    dude I cant believe when I wanted to make a project about animation heavily stuff I found your videos explaining just the things I need most, you are amazing very muhc appreciated

  • @petermoss7387
    @petermoss7387 Рік тому

    The additive animation explanation was amazing! I’m having my characters torso aim through IK but that is definitely something I could utilize

  • @androvisuals6863
    @androvisuals6863 3 роки тому

    I'd love to see a short version of this showing how to do it with the generic setup. Great work as always!

  • @unitynocode
    @unitynocode 2 роки тому +1

    Thank you ! All your videos are very detailed and useful

  • @Bunnunoox
    @Bunnunoox 3 роки тому

    I'm a huge fan of how clearly you explain things. Thank you!

  • @brainwavestobinary
    @brainwavestobinary 3 роки тому

    Nice content. I like how some channels lately have been really focusing hard on particular topics. Not that I want anyone to be pigeon-holed into anything, but the depth that some creators are going with topics like this is fantastic!

  • @arthurgentz2
    @arthurgentz2 3 роки тому +7

    If i had the money, i'd fund and implore you to start an in-depth, AAA-level animation course. Very good work.

    • @iHeartGameDev
      @iHeartGameDev  3 роки тому +2

      Thank you Arthur! I really appreciate the kindness!

  • @user-uo3wz4dq1j
    @user-uo3wz4dq1j 3 роки тому

    Exactly the tutorial I was looking for, thank you so much!

  • @3jkptradingandservices998
    @3jkptradingandservices998 Рік тому

    Omg, you explained it very simply! It's really easy to understand. Thank you so much! I've always wanted to learn these.

  • @leeoiou7295
    @leeoiou7295 Рік тому

    Your teaching style stand above all others. Great job!

  • @TNTCProject
    @TNTCProject 3 роки тому

    Well done Nicky! Awesome video as always :)

  • @Akesss
    @Akesss 3 роки тому

    Best and cleanest tutorial. You don't left any doors open behind. Thank you!

  • @AlekMat
    @AlekMat 3 роки тому +1

    Searched true hundreds of videos on youtube to find this gold, totaly worth it good job !

    • @iHeartGameDev
      @iHeartGameDev  3 роки тому

      Happy you found it!! Thanks for watching!

  • @losfouad2014
    @losfouad2014 3 роки тому

    You're really doing a great job ! thanks for your tutorials man !

  • @jasonalarcio7644
    @jasonalarcio7644 Рік тому

    I paused as you went along and did the steps myself and that helped a TON.

  • @Gwynbleidd27_
    @Gwynbleidd27_ 3 роки тому +2

    This is so underrated, this channel is pure gold! thank you so much for these tutorials so far the best i've seen on youtube

    • @iHeartGameDev
      @iHeartGameDev  3 роки тому +2

      Thanks so much!! Happy to hear that the content is still helpful!

  • @Aurillia
    @Aurillia 3 роки тому

    Amazing tutorial, you are crystal clear, and brilliant at teaching. Good up the good work! :D

  • @rachitjasoria001
    @rachitjasoria001 3 роки тому +1

    I was looking for the good tutorial on this topic. And I found the perfect one.😍😍

  • @pratyushbarikdev
    @pratyushbarikdev 3 роки тому

    Can’t believe that this is the first tutorial that shows the animation features of unity. I’m not sure why no one has covered it till now. Found out about this channel so late.

  • @ragnar8871
    @ragnar8871 Рік тому

    non ho mai visto tutorial così approfonditi...grazie mille amico!!!😎

  • @zrkzheng7604
    @zrkzheng7604 2 роки тому +1

    I do learn a lot from this awesome tutorial. Thanks !!! 😘

  • @LucidWarlocks
    @LucidWarlocks Рік тому

    Very in depth explanation. Thanks a heap buddy

  • @018FLP
    @018FLP 2 роки тому +1

    Another super well explained and paced tutorial! This you be extra handy for me, thank you very much!

  • @ramizmollah8279
    @ramizmollah8279 3 роки тому

    I am overwhelmed by your quality of explanation. Thank you

  • @dean_allan
    @dean_allan 6 місяців тому

    Wow you can sync layers with the main layer!? You have saved my life thank you!

  • @XThunderBoltFilms
    @XThunderBoltFilms 3 роки тому

    Fantastic video. Extremely well done, helpful, well organized.

  • @gatesaims
    @gatesaims 2 роки тому +1

    Thank you saved me a lot of time trying to browse videos for an actual working one

  • @zhaoxuefei3829
    @zhaoxuefei3829 3 роки тому

    such a well explained videos!!! really good

  • @yassernareth3034
    @yassernareth3034 2 роки тому +1

    Really helpfull tutorials. Helped a lot

  • @supershinobiartist5231
    @supershinobiartist5231 3 роки тому

    Well done,Nicky!really appreciate this video.

  • @banjo7312
    @banjo7312 Рік тому

    Thank you for the Playlist. At least I have lessons being learned in order. Focus guaranteed. Thankyou. Great work Sir. Michael.

  • @michaelwilson8461
    @michaelwilson8461 3 роки тому

    Nice clear explanations, as always. Thank ya kindly.

  • @rajasreedebnath2017
    @rajasreedebnath2017 Рік тому +1

    tNice tutorials is detailed, its amazin thanks man!

  • @dvncan6717
    @dvncan6717 Рік тому

    Great video as always!

  • @dumbledoor1403
    @dumbledoor1403 Рік тому

    This was so helpful!! Thank you

  • @Majestyma
    @Majestyma 2 роки тому

    Great tutorial, the way you explain thing is perfect. Thank you

  • @Oleg_UE5
    @Oleg_UE5 2 роки тому

    Damn, I had payed for a unity learning course but this series is free and 100 times better. I can not recommend it more. GREAT tutorial.

  • @user-ih3xv6mx5p
    @user-ih3xv6mx5p 10 місяців тому +2

    Your lessons so useful! Awesome!

  • @Mohammed-kl9px
    @Mohammed-kl9px 3 роки тому

    I hope one day Unity reaches you out because how amazing and informative your tutorials are. Many thanks for you.

  • @FAISAL-ky7ps
    @FAISAL-ky7ps 3 роки тому

    You really my hero Nicky, You save me.
    This tutorial is really Awesome. Best Recommended channel Animation Tutorial Unity3D

  • @HadiLePanda
    @HadiLePanda 3 роки тому

    Really nice tutorial, the content is very helpful and the presentation is great :)

  • @viraj3944
    @viraj3944 4 місяці тому +1

    This was an amazing video. Will go to the IK video next

  • @torppe2226
    @torppe2226 3 роки тому

    Great tutorials on a bit more advanced topics. Just what I needed!

    • @torppe2226
      @torppe2226 3 роки тому

      Also looking forward to the IK video :)

  • @Chronomatrix
    @Chronomatrix 3 роки тому

    omg that's a lot of information to take in, I'm gonna have to watch this 10 times at least. Great tutorial.

  • @Kncperseus
    @Kncperseus 3 роки тому

    Heyyyy, man! Been wondering when the next video would be coming on! Good as usual!

  • @thescotster19
    @thescotster19 8 місяців тому

    This has been an utterly brilliant series. Fantastic presentation and attention to detail. I now know what the Unity animation system is capable of, and what I want to implement. I am doing a 2D humanoid animation but the principles will apply. Thank you @iHeartGameDev.

  • @LeeGrey
    @LeeGrey 3 роки тому

    This is an excellent series. Thanks :)

  • @lukavekichannel
    @lukavekichannel 3 роки тому

    Bro u killing it with tutorial i love it !!!

  • @chriswillis7731
    @chriswillis7731 3 роки тому +1

    Fantastic tutorial mate! you do a great pace and explain everything - I tip my metaphorical hat to you!

  • @pnpandey86
    @pnpandey86 Рік тому

    very nice explanation dude.
    Thank you man for such a tutorial.

  • @lordkakabel76
    @lordkakabel76 Рік тому

    Thank you! I was able to make my player walk with a torch when in the darkness super-easy with this method.

  • @michaelperkins1119
    @michaelperkins1119 3 роки тому

    Awesome Tutorial. Can't wait for the IK one.

  • @thealonely2639
    @thealonely2639 3 роки тому

    Your work is Brilliant! please Continue I love your content and Video form your Video is so Rare to find. Don't Give up.

  • @halivudestevez2
    @halivudestevez2 Рік тому

    Need to repeat viewing this several times. Vaste of essential information.

  • @TenYearsOldGamer
    @TenYearsOldGamer 2 роки тому

    Amazing! exactly what i wanted , Thank you ❤

  • @MusicalKeyboardRaghav9999
    @MusicalKeyboardRaghav9999 Рік тому

    Love you bro this is so helpful keep it up.

  • @inorishu1877
    @inorishu1877 3 роки тому

    Keep making tutorials.... really love how you explain things🔥

  • @aaravsbag6969
    @aaravsbag6969 Рік тому

    U gotta make it look so easy, thx bro!

  • @rektsammy
    @rektsammy 3 роки тому

    Amazing work!

  • @peche87_gameDev
    @peche87_gameDev 3 роки тому

    Very clear video! I would like to see about IK now. Great content :)

  • @ynguyennhuthien9205
    @ynguyennhuthien9205 3 роки тому

    Respect !
    I needed it and you saved me, thank you so much.

  • @GameDesignverse
    @GameDesignverse 2 роки тому +1

    Damn man your smile melts hearts away. Besides you explain things like bread and butter. Cool.

  • @aarondavidlewis
    @aarondavidlewis 3 роки тому

    Your tutorials are really excellent. I especially love the pacing... you are including everything even a newbie needs to know, but its not slow at all, and its also not a lightning fast Brackeys style sprint (I love Brackeys but I have to keep shuttling back and forth because its always a DELUGE of info). Keep it up - and maybe considering doing a few scripting tutorials as well, maybe even with downloadable scripts to work along with. I find that scripting examples for Unity tutorials are generally quite hard to come by. Just an idea .... I love what you're doing.

  • @user-fv6vl8ho5s
    @user-fv6vl8ho5s 3 роки тому

    yes, truely best. very clear and percise

  • @hanchan3233
    @hanchan3233 3 роки тому

    very high quality tutorial, keep it up!

  • @rufatismaylov535
    @rufatismaylov535 3 роки тому

    Amazing video! Thank you very much for this tutorial!

  • @ZamirUddin
    @ZamirUddin 2 роки тому +1

    thanks man. very helpful.

  • @tauheedgamedev2388
    @tauheedgamedev2388 3 роки тому

    Great Animation Tutorial, Definitely gonna need this when i make some 3D games. 👍 Subbed

  • @AlesAlex
    @AlesAlex 3 роки тому

    Love your channel! I would like to see some tutorial about procedural animation in the future

  • @FaffyWaffles
    @FaffyWaffles 3 роки тому +1

    Another Amazing Tutorial

  • @jean-michel.houbre
    @jean-michel.houbre 3 роки тому

    Very informative. Thank you so much.

  • @kaos7149
    @kaos7149 3 роки тому

    bro its like ur entering into my head and explaining exactly what i want exactly how i want.. don't have the words to thank u enough

    • @iHeartGameDev
      @iHeartGameDev  3 роки тому +1

      Hahaha thank you!! Love to hear that!

  • @martinluterelectronics8619
    @martinluterelectronics8619 Рік тому

    was a life-saver. Thanks a lot.

  •  3 роки тому

    This is awesome. Thank you :)

  • @ChezzeGK
    @ChezzeGK Рік тому

    Best dev tutorial guy on yt i swear

  • @tottalyykmadgaming4886
    @tottalyykmadgaming4886 Рік тому

    it worked! thank you so much!!

  • @URODengine
    @URODengine 2 роки тому +1

    Hello, thank you very much for this great tutorial, now I clearly understand the need for layers and an avatar mask. You are the best of those who have explained this topic :)

  • @sabythenoob
    @sabythenoob 3 роки тому

    Thank you sooooooooooo much... For past 4years I wanted to learn about combining multiple animation...

  • @leonardojensen2654
    @leonardojensen2654 3 роки тому +1

    Easily one of the best unity channels out there

  • @DwipMakwana
    @DwipMakwana Рік тому

    Thanks for the hardwork on behalf of all us game devs, appreciation +100XP!